Thomas R. Polte is a scholar working on Cell Biology, Immunology and Allergy and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Thomas R. Polte has authored 18 papers receiving a total of 4.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Cell Biology, 10 papers in Immunology and Allergy and 7 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Thomas R. Polte’s work include Cellular Mechanics and Interactions (13 papers), Cell Adhesion Molecules Research (10 papers) and Protein Kinase Regulation and GTPase Signaling (3 papers). Thomas R. Polte is often cited by papers focused on Cellular Mechanics and Interactions (13 papers), Cell Adhesion Molecules Research (10 papers) and Protein Kinase Regulation and GTPase Signaling (3 papers). Thomas R. Polte collaborates with scholars based in United States and Japan. Thomas R. Polte's co-authors include Steven K. Hanks, Mihail CALALB, Donald E. Ingber, Ning Wang, Leslie A. Cary, Jun‐Lin Guan, Tanmay P. Lele, Eric Mazur, Sanjay Kumar and Alexander Heisterkamp and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Journal of Biological Chemistry and Circulation.
